> When one tries to load the TikZ data visualization library, the documents does not compile anymore. The error is “.../tikzlibrarydatavisualization.code.tex: ! Missing number, treated as zero”.
>
> I have also tried this using ConTeXt online, to the same end:
> http://live.contextgarden.net/cgi-bin/output.cgi?id=jSjLZO
>
> \usemodule[tikz]
> \usetikzlibrary{datavisualization}
> \starttext
> Hello world!
> \stoptext
>
> Is this a known bug or could I somehow fix this to get data visualization to work?

\unprotect
\usetikzlibrary{datavisualization}
\protect
